  • 1. 

    What is the correct abbreviation for usted?

    • A.

      Us.

    • B.

      Usd.

    • C.

      Ud.

    • D.

      Ustd.

    Correct Answer
    C. Ud.
    Explanation
    The correct abbreviation for "usted" is "Ud." In Spanish, "usted" is a formal way of addressing someone, similar to the English "you." The abbreviation "Ud." is used to represent "usted" in written communication as it is shorter and more convenient.

  • 4. 

    What is the abbreviation for ustedes?

    • A.

      Usds.

    • B.

      Utds.

    • C.

      Uds.

    • D.

      Udes.

    Correct Answer
    C. Uds.
    Explanation
    The correct answer is "Uds." The abbreviation "Uds." stands for "ustedes" in Spanish, which is the plural form of "usted" meaning "you" in formal context. This abbreviation is commonly used in written communication to address or refer to a group of people in a respectful manner.

  • 7. 

    How many males are required for the subject to turn to masculine? For example, ellos vs. ellas 

    • A.

      Males must outnumber the females

    • B.

      Males have to be at least half of the group.

    • C.

      Two or more.

    • D.

      Just one.

    Correct Answer
    D. Just one.
    Explanation
    The subject can turn to masculine with just one male. This means that even if there is only one male in the group, the subject will be considered masculine. It is not necessary for males to outnumber females or for males to be at least half of the group. As long as there is at least one male, the subject will be masculine.

  • 11. 

    In which Spanish-speaking country is vosotros/as used?

    • A.

      Spain

    • B.

      Mexico

    • C.

      Guatemala

    • D.

      Cuba

    Correct Answer
    A. Spain
    Explanation
    In Spain, the pronoun "vosotros/as" is used. This pronoun is the plural form of "you" and is used when addressing a group of people informally. In other Spanish-speaking countries like Mexico, Guatemala, and Cuba, the pronoun "ustedes" is used instead. "Ustedes" is the formal plural form of "you" and is used in both formal and informal situations. Therefore, the correct answer is Spain.

  • 14. 

    With which type of person would you not use tú?

    • A.

      Friends

    • B.

      Pets

    • C.

      Complete strangers

    • D.

      People your own age

    Correct Answer
    C. Complete strangers
    Explanation
    Tú is the informal form of "you" in Spanish and is typically used with people with whom you have a close or familiar relationship, such as friends and people your own age. However, when addressing complete strangers, it is more appropriate to use the formal form of "you" which is usted. Therefore, tú would not be used with complete strangers.
